SECTION 1801 SEPARABILITY
Should any article, section or provisions of this Ordinance be declared by the courts to be
unconstitutional or invalid, such decision shall not affect the validity of this Ordinance as a whole, or
any part thereof other than the part so declared to be unconstitutional or invalid.
SECTION 1802 PURPOSE OF CATCH HEADS
The catch heads appearing in connection with the foregoing sections are inserted simply for
convenience, to serve the purpose of an index and they shall be wholly disregarded by any person,
officer, court or other tribunal in construing the terms and provisions of this Ordinance.
SECTION 1803 REPEAL OF CONFLICTING ORDINANCES
All Ordinances or parts of Ordinances in conflict with this Ordinance are hereby repealed to the
extent necessary to give this Ordinance full force and effect.
SECTION 1804 EFFECTIVE DATE
This Ordinance shall take effect and be in force from and after its passage and publication in pamphlet
form as provided by law.
